Key Features for Data Visualization and Dashboards

Out-of-the-Box Dashboards

SystemLink enables teams to generate and update dashboards for viewing key performance indicators, test results, and calibration data. Advanced customization options support enterprise-level requirements.

Real-Time Monitoring

SystemLink allows users to build drag-and-drop dashboards for alarms and telemetry providing live visibility into test and measurement data across systems.

Native Integration with the NI LabVIEW+ Suite

SystemLink supports seamless data uploads from NI FlexLogger and NI TestStand to SystemLink in just a few clicks. It also includes an NI LabVIEW API for publishing measurement and telemetry data directly.
